Buscar

ARQUITETURA E ORGANIZACAO DE COMPUTADORES - ATIVIDADE 2

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 6 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 6, do total de 6 páginas

Prévia do material em texto

· Pergunta 1
1 em 1 pontos
	
	
	
	Quando uma pessoa utiliza um computador ocorre o processamento de informações e desta maneira a execução de diversas instruções durante o processamento. A forma como as instruções são divididas ocorre conforme algumas etapas e devem acompanhar o funcionamento dos módulos e suas conexões, no datapath.
Considerando esse contexto, analise as seguintes afirmações.
I. Após o RI ser carregado ocorre o incremento de PC com o endereço da próxima instrução.
II. Na primeira etapa da divisão das instruções, é o carregamento do registrador RI.
III. Em uma das fases da divisão ocorre a execução da instrução.
IV. Após a última fase, ou seja, o retorno ao início, ocorre o registro do resultado.
Assinale a alternativa que mostra o que é correto afirmar.
	
	
	
	
		Resposta Selecionada:
	 
As afirmativas I e III estão corretas.
	Resposta Correta:
	 
As afirmativas I e III estão corretas.
	Feedback da resposta:
	Resposta correta. A resposta está correta pois após o carregamento do registrador de instruções RI, ocorre o incremento do registrador PC com o endereço da próxima instrução.
	
	
	
· Pergunta 2
1 em 1 pontos
	
	
	
	Após a execução das instruções ocorre o tratamento das interrupções, ou seja, as interrupções não são tratadas durante a execução das instruções, mas sim após seu término. As interrupções entram na fila de execução e ao final da execução da instrução poderão ser tratadas de duas formas. A interrupção poderá ser tratada sequencialmente ou de forma aninhada.
Considerando esse contexto, analise as seguintes afirmações.
I. No processo de interrupção aninhada o tratamento ocorre após o tratamento da primeira interrupção.
II. No processo sequencial, o tratamento ocorre ao final da execução da primeira interrupção.
III. Durante o processo de execução de instruções, as interrupções não são tratadas.
IV. O processo sequencial pode ocorrer somente após o tratamento do processo de interrupção aninhada.
Assinale a alternativa que mostra o que é correto afirmar.
	
	
	
	
		Resposta Selecionada:
	 
Somente a afirmativa II está correta.
	Resposta Correta:
	 
Somente a afirmativa II está correta.
	Feedback da resposta:
	Resposta correta. O método de tratamento aninhado promove o tratamento da segunda interrupção durante a execução da primeira interrupção.
	
	
	
· Pergunta 3
1 em 1 pontos
	
	
	
	As informações de são processadas pelo computador possuem uma característica específica, assim, os computadores não são capazes de “entender” diretamente a nossa linguagem. Os dados que são representados no computador devem seguir um modelo de representação binária pois os circuitos do computador não conseguem ler diretamente a nossa linguagem.
Considerando esse contexto, analise as seguintes afirmações.
I. O sistema numérico binário é composto pelos símbolos 0 e 1.
II. As informações processadas no computador são representadas por combinações de sequências binárias.
III. Um bit pode assumir o valor 01.
IV. Um bit pode assumir o valor 0 e 1.
Assinale a alternativa que mostra o que é correto afirmar.
	
	
	
	
		Resposta Selecionada:
	 
As afirmativas I e II estão corretas.
	Resposta Correta:
	 
As afirmativas I e II estão corretas.
	Feedback da resposta:
	Resposta correta. A resposta está correta pois conforme estudamos o sistema binário é composto pelos símbolos 0 e 1 e as informações são apenas sequências de combinações destes dois símbolos.
	
	
	
· Pergunta 4
1 em 1 pontos
	
	
	
	As instruções são divididas em diversas fases durante o processo de execução, sendo que ao final da execução são verificadas as interrupções pendentes de tratamento. Posteriormente o fluxo de tratamento das interrupções entrariam no pipeline, podendo ser realizadas duas formas de tratamentos, o processamento sequencial e o aninhado.
Sobre as instruções, podemos dizer que é correto afirmar que
	
	
	
	
		Resposta Selecionada:
	 
o processo de tratamento das interrupções ocorre após a execução da instrução.
	Resposta Correta:
	 
o processo de tratamento das interrupções ocorre após a execução da instrução.
	Feedback da resposta:
	Resposta correta. A resposta está correta pois as instruções são executadas e em seguida ocorre o processamento das interrupções.
	
	
	
· Pergunta 5
1 em 1 pontos
	
	
	
	O computador é um equipamento composto por diversos módulos. Dentre estes módulos encontramos a CPU que é composta por submódulos, muito importantes para o funcionamento do computador, dentre os quais a unidade lógica e aritmética, a unidade de controle e os registradores. Cada um destes módulos possui função específica.
Nesse sentido, assinale com V, as alternativas verdadeiras, e com F, as alternativas falsas.
(_) A unidade lógica e aritmética é responsável por efetuar operações lógicas e aritméticas.
(_) A ULA é capaz de controlar a execução das operações, enviando sinais de controle.
(_) A ULA é responsável pelo armazenamento interno do processador.
(_) A ULA não desempenha função importante durante o processamento das informações.
Agora, assinale a alternativa que apresenta a sequência correta de respostas.
	
	
	
	
		Resposta Selecionada:
	 
V, F, F e F.
	Resposta Correta:
	 
V, F, F e F.
	Feedback da resposta:
	Resposta correta. A resposta está correta pois a função da unidade lógica e aritmética – ULA é realizar operações lógica e aritmética.
	
	
	
· Pergunta 6
1 em 1 pontos
	
	
	
	Os processadores são capazes de realizar tarefas complexas a partir de uma série de operações simples. Isto ocorre por meio da execução de instruções que são escritas em formato específico para poderem serem interpretadas pelos módulos do computador. Os processadores são capazes de manipular quatro classes de instruções.
Considerando esse contexto, analise as seguintes afirmações.
I. O processador e os módulos de entrada e saída são intercambiados pelas classes de instruções do processador -E/S.
II. As classes de instruções de controle estão relacionadas aos desvios condicionais e não condicionais.
III. As classes de processamento apenas enviam sinais de controle.
IV. As classes de processamento apenas realizam a transferência de dados.
Assinale a alternativa que mostra o que é correto afirmar.
	
	
	
	
		Resposta Selecionada:
	 
As afirmativas I e II estão corretas.
	Resposta Correta:
	 
As afirmativas I e II estão corretas.
	Feedback da resposta:
	Resposta correta. A resposta está correta pois processador – E/S, e controle são classes de instruções.
	
	
	
· Pergunta 7
1 em 1 pontos
	
	
	
	O processador efetua a busca e execução das instruções. Na realidade este processo é dividido em várias etapas que podem ser executadas de forma sequencial ou otimizadas através de fluxo de processamento por meio da técnica de pipeline. Algumas ocorrências como o desvio de fluxo podem alterar o processo de busca e execução de instruções.
Nesse sentido, assinale com V, as alternativas verdadeiras, e com F, as alternativas falsas.
(_) Durante o processo de divisão da instrução ocorre o carregamento apenas do opcode.
(_) Após a instrução ser executada e registrada ocorre novamente o início do ciclo da próxima instrução.
(_) Após a busca da instrução, ocorre a codificação do tipo de instrução.
(_) Após o carregamento do registrador RI, as instruções são decodificadas.
Agora, assinale a alternativa que apresenta a sequência correta de respostas.
	
	
	
	
		Resposta Selecionada:
	 
F, V, F e F.
	Resposta Correta:
	 
F, V, F e F.
	Feedback da resposta:
	Resposta correta. A resposta está correta pois a execução e registro é a última etapa do processo de divisão da instrução, iniciando-se posteriormente o processo de divisão da próxima instrução.
	
	
	
· Pergunta 8
1 em 1 pontos
	
	
	
	Em arquitetura e organização de computadores estuda-se que os computadores são compostos por diversos módulos, sendo um deles a CPU onde estão os registradores. Existem várias classes de registradores, podendo-se citar alguns tipos: (a) PC (program counter); (b) IR (instruction register); (c) MAR (memoryaddress memory); (d) MBR (memory buffer register), dentre outros. Cada registrador é utilizado para uma função diferente.
Analise cada conjunto de informações e assinale:
(P) Registradores de propósito geral.
(S) Registradores de estado e controle.
(A) Não são considerados registradores.
(_) Um registrado chamado BB é utilizado, em um determinado projeto, para armazenar informações.
(_) O registrador PC é utilizado para armazenar endereço da próxima instrução.
(_) Registradores que carregam a instrução que será executada posteriormente existem.
(_) A unidade de entrada e saída contribui para a eficiência de processamento.
(_) O registrador a é utilizado para armazenar resultados de operações matemáticas no projeto de determinado computador.
Agora, assinale a alternativa que apresenta a sequência correta de respostas.
	
	
	
	
		Resposta Selecionada:
	 
P, S, S, A e P.
	Resposta Correta:
	 
P, S, S, A e P.
	Feedback da resposta:
	Resposta correta. A resposta está correta pois os registradores de propósito geral servem para armazenar diversos tipos de dados, podendo também armazenar dados provenientes de outro registrador.
	
	
	
· Pergunta 9
1 em 1 pontos
	
	
	
	O processador é responsável pelo processamento das informações. As informações são compostas por muitas instruções, ou seja, informações mais simples capazes de ser “entendidas” pelos módulos do computador, como ULA, UC, registradores etc. Para que as instruções sejam executadas passam por um processo onde são divididas e manipuladas, podendo sofrer interrupções. Algumas das etapas de divisão das instruções são: (a) busca; (b) carregamento; (c) interrupção; (d) execução; (e) codificação. Estas etapas podem ser representadas por meio de esquema básico e detalhado.
Analise cada item a seguir, marcando B para Esquema básico, D para Esquema detalhado e A quando pertence a ambas.
(_) Cálculo do endereço do operando.
(_) Busca da instrução.
(_) Cálculo de endereço da instrução.
(_) Decodificação da instrução.
(_) Operação de dados.
Agora, assinale a alternativa que apresenta a sequência correta de respostas.
	
	
	
	
		Resposta Selecionada:
	 
D, A, D, D e D.
	Resposta Correta:
	 
D, A, D, D e D.
	Feedback da resposta:
	Resposta correta. A resposta está correta pois no esquema básico tempos a busca, execução e interrupção.
	
	
	
· Pergunta 10
1 em 1 pontos
	
	
	
	Atualmente muitos equipamentos são utilizados para a realização das tarefas do dia a dia, sendo que muitos destes equipamentos possuem microprocessadores próprios. Estas arquiteturas específicas têm características próprias e são desenvolvidas para suprir necessidades de equipamentos cuja utilização não é adequada em plataformas prontas.
Dados as situações a seguir, classifique-as como P (relacionados a arquiteturas prontas) ou como E
(relacionados a arquiteturas específicas).
(_) Se uma determinada empresa produz uma série de computadores pessoais.
(_) Se uma construtora solicitou um projeto de automação para ser utilizado em um edifício.
(_) Se um vídeo game danificado necessita ser reparado com novos componentes.
(_) Se um projeto de determinado equipamento não pode ser utilizado em uma plataforma pronta.
(_) Se há necessidade de criar um equipamento com processador, registradores e fluxo de dados específicos.
Agora, escolha a alternativa que traz a sequência correta de respostas.
	
	
	
	
		Resposta Selecionada:
	 
P, E, P, E e E.
	Resposta Correta:
	 
P, E, P, E e E.
	Feedback da resposta:
	Resposta correta. A resposta está correta pois equipamentos produzidos em série utilizam plataformas prontas e equipamentos sob encomenda ou característicos, necessitam de arquiteturas específicas com projeto próprio de processador, registradores e fluxo de dados.

Outros materiais